person person person

Belur S Sreenath, MD

Internist
apartment Saint Petersburg, FL
No reviews
Avg Wait Time
Not Enough Data

3901 66TH ST N SUITE 201, Saint Petersburg, FL, 33709

Fax: (727) 345-6164